Output eaf13ade59a7f33b10dde1d7e74d1804b8205d4e9b7cf9d06a52cd3bb2af12ad:0

value
2660000
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 0e3689d94b72cf91cb0a138b2b9647a316d9c628 OP_EQUALVERIFY OP_CHECKSIG
address
LLX74JF4Toeuy76Hn5h1JEfkvPe71TxHcr
transaction
eaf13ade59a7f33b10dde1d7e74d1804b8205d4e9b7cf9d06a52cd3bb2af12ad
spent
true